RETIRED BADGE - 2003 TO PRESENT
The Retired Firefighter badge was changed in 2003 when the majority of Firefighters voted to go with the traditional maltese cross department badge.
The one shown, #26 was a sample that I had made up with my badge number on it.
This is the one that I actually carry now.
The first one issued by I.A.F.F. Local 2081 went to Retired Firefighter Vic Egg #25.
